Fine-tuning the Pitch You can fine tune the pitch of the entire instrument in approximately 0.2 Hz increments. This lets you match the keyboard pitch finely to that of other instruments or CD music. Setting range: 414.8 - 440.0 - 466.8 Hz To lower the pitch: While holding down [GRAND PIANO/FUNCTION], press the G#6 key repeatedly to lower the pitch in approximately 0.2 Hz increments. To raise the pitch: While holding down [GRAND PIANO/FUNCTION], press the A6 key repeatedly to raise the pitch in approximately 0.2 Hz increments. To set the pitch to A3 = 442.0 Hz: While holding down [GRAND PIANO/FUNCTION], press the A#6 key. To reset the pitch to the default (A3 = 440.0 Hz): While holding down [GRAND PIANO/FUNCTION], press the B6 key.
